Lora Tanetta Davis was born in 1898 in Newton, Arkansas, USA, the child of George Washington Davis And Lucinda Elizabeth Ann Rutledge. In 1920, Lora Tanetta Davis resided in Jackson, Newton, Arkansas, USA. In 1935, Lora Tanetta Davis resided in Jasper, Newton, Arkansas. Lora Tanetta Davis married Okla A Moore. Lora Tanetta Davis passed away in 1968 in Jasper, Newton County, Arkansas, United States of America.
